MLA Kangan seeks compensation for windstorm victims | KNO

Srinagar, May 19 (KNO): National Conference leader and MLA Kangan, Mian Mehar Ali on Monday urged the authorities to provide relief and compensation to the windstorm hit people in Kangan constituency. In a statement issued to the news agency—Kashmir News Observer (KNO), Mehar Ali said, “The severe windstorm that struck different areas of Kangan constituency last night, caused considerable damage to residential homes.” The MLA Kangan called on the authorities to assess the damages and provide immediate relief to the sufferers. The MLA Kangan, according to the statement, spoke to Tehsildar Gund, Tehsildar Kangan and Tehsildar Lar. He sought compensation and effective rehabilitation for the sufferers. “Relief teams have already been deployed to assess the extent of the damage and provide aid,” the officials told the NC leader—(KNO)
